Much beloved by TV-sports-logo designers and ad agencies, computer animation technology has yielded only a handful of memorable short films. This hour-long anthology features two goodies — the neo-psychedelic Embryo and the dazzling sci-fi/film noir tribute Blind Love. What's left of Computer Animation Festival is either cloyingly cute, cynically sadistic, or just numbingly ordinary, proving that even the snazziest technology can never pull you out of a creative void.
